Volatility: The Hidden Variable
One of the most critical aspects of understanding Crazy Hunter’s odds is grasping its volatility. Volatility refers to the degree of variation in a slot machine’s payouts over time. Games with high volatility tend to offer larger wins less frequently, while low-volatility games provide more modest payouts at a higher frequency.

RTP: A Key Performance Indicator
The Return-to-Player (RTP) percentage is another essential metric in evaluating Crazy Hunter’s odds. RTP represents the amount of money returned to players as winnings relative to the amount wagered. In other words, it’s a measure of how much the game pays out on average.

Hit Frequency: The Pattern of Payouts
The hit frequency of Crazy Hunter is another critical factor influencing the game’s overall probability. Hit frequency refers to how often the slot machine pays out, with more frequent hits typically resulting in lower payouts and less frequent hits yielding larger wins.
